Acute Ruptured Intracranial Aneurysm Packing with HydroCoil Embolic System: Initial Clinical Experience.

Peng Ya1, Xuan Jing-Gang, Yang Yi-Lin, Wang Sui-Nuan.   

Abstract

The HydroCoil Embolic System (HES; MicroVention, Aliso Viejo, CA, USA) was developed to improve the efficacy of endovascular treatment of cerebral aneurysms. The HES may reduce recurrences of aneurysms by allowing for increased packing density compared with platinum coils. We report our initial experience with the HES in the treatment of 31 patients with acute ruptured cerebral aneurysms. The HES is another safe and effective material for aneurysms embolization, which provided substantially improved volumetric packing of the aneurysm lumen.
